В IndexedDB есть ли способ сделать отсортированный составной запрос?

Скажем, в таблице есть: имя, ID, возраст, пол, образование и т. Д. ID - это ключ, и в таблице также указываются имя, возраст и пол. Мне нужны все ученики старше 25 лет, отсортированные по именам.

Это легко в MySQL:

    SELECT * FROM table WHERE age > 25 AND sex = "M" ORDER BY name

IndexDB позволяет создавать индекс и упорядочивать запрос на основе этого индекса. Но он не допускает множественных запросов, таких как возраст и пол. Я нашел небольшую библиотеку под названием queryIndexedDB (https://github.com/philikon/queryIndexedDB), которая позволяет составлять запросы, но не дает отсортированных результатов.

Так есть ли способ сделать отсортированный составной запрос, используя IndexedDB?

Ответы на вопрос(5)

Ваш ответ на вопрос